Devotees queue up in large numbers at Kashi Vishwanath temple on Maha Shivaratri
Varanasi, March 8 -- In a display of devotion and religious fervour, hundreds of devotees gathered at the iconic Kashi Vishwanath temple in Varanasi to celebrate Maha Shivaratri on Friday.
The occasion drew worshippers from far and wide, forming long queues as they eagerly sought the blessings of Lord Shiva.
To ensure the smooth flow of the crowd, law enforcement agencies swiftly swung into action to manage the crowd outside the temple.
In Uttar Pradesh's Prayagraj, a significant number of devotees were seen taking a dip in the holy waters of Sangham ghat on the occasion.
